What Exactly Are PVC Wall Panels 4x8?

At their core, PVC wall panels 4x8 are large, rigid sheets made from polyvinyl chloride (PVC), a versatile plastic polymer. The "4x8" designation refers to their standard dimensions: 4 feet in width and 8 feet in length, creating a total coverage area of 32 square feet per panel. This large format is a game-changer, significantly reducing the number of seams in a finished wall compared to smaller tiles or planks. They come in a vast array of finishes, from smooth, solid colors that mimic paint to highly detailed textures that replicate the look of brick, stone, wood, or even modern geometric patterns. The panels are typically designed with a tongue-and-groove or shiplap edge system, allowing them to interlock securely for a seamless, professional appearance without the need for visible fasteners or grout lines.

The construction of these panels is what sets them apart. They are often hollow-core or multi-layer composites, engineered for strength while remaining lightweight. A typical 4x8 PVC panel might weigh between 15 to 25 pounds, making it manageable for a single person to handle and install. This is a stark contrast to a solid wood or cement board of the same size, which would be prohibitively heavy. The material is inherently non-porous and impervious to water, meaning it won't warp, rot, or support mold growth, even in saturated conditions. This fundamental property is the cornerstone of their popularity in high-moisture environments.

The Unbeatable Durability and Moisture Resistance

The primary driver for choosing PVC wall panels, especially in the 4x8 size, is their legendary moisture resistance and durability. Unlike drywall, which can disintegrate when exposed to water, or wood, which can rot and warp, PVC is completely unaffected by humidity, splashes, and even direct water contact. This makes 4x8 PVC panels the ultimate solution for:

  • Bathrooms and showers: They create a perfect, waterproof barrier behind tile or as a standalone wall covering.
  • Kitchens: Ideal for backsplashes and walls behind sinks where steam and splatters are constant.
  • Basements and garages: They resist the damp, musty conditions that plague these spaces.
  • Commercial settings: Food processing plants, car washes, laboratories, and healthcare facilities rely on PVC panels for hygienic, easy-to-clean walls that meet strict sanitation codes.

The impact resistance of PVC is another major plus. These panels can withstand bumps, scrapes, and everyday wear far better than painted drywall or thin wall tiles. In a busy family home, a scuff from a chair or a toy bump won't leave a permanent mark. For commercial or industrial use, they can handle the occasional tool or equipment brush without damage. This resilience translates directly to a longer lifespan and lower lifetime cost, as you won't need to repair or replace damaged sections frequently.

Effortless Installation: A DIYer's Dream

If the thought of a renovation project brings to mind days of messy demolition, wet saws, and grouting nightmares, PVC wall panels 4x8 will feel like a revelation. The installation process is remarkably straightforward, often requiring only basic tools and a weekend for a typical room. The most common method is a direct-to-stud or direct-to-wall installation.

Here’s a simplified step-by-step overview:

  1. Preparation: Ensure your wall substrate (studs, drywall, concrete block) is clean, dry, and structurally sound. Remove any old fixtures, outlet covers, and trim.
  2. Layout: Start from a corner or the center of your most visible wall. Use a level to mark a plumb line. It's often best to begin with a full panel on the main wall.
  3. Cutting: Measure and mark your panels. A circular saw with a fine-tooth blade or a jigsaw is ideal for cutting PVC. Always cut from the finished side to avoid chipping.
  4. Fitting: Apply a recommended construction adhesive (like a high-quality polyurethane or PVC-specific adhesive) to the back of the panel or directly to the wall. Press the panel firmly into place, ensuring the tongue-and-groove edges interlock tightly with the previous panel.
  5. Securing: While adhesive is often sufficient, especially on flat surfaces, nailing or screwing through the panel's "nailing fin" (a built-in flange on the back) into the studs provides extra security, particularly on vertical walls. Use corrosion-resistant fasteners.
  6. Finishing: Once all panels are installed, reinstall outlet and switch boxes (using extenders if needed), and reattach baseboard, crown molding, or other trim. The panels' edges are designed to be covered by trim for a polished look.

Pro Tip: Always acclimate your panels in the room where they'll be installed for at least 24 hours before cutting. This allows the material to adjust to the local temperature and humidity, preventing expansion or contraction issues after installation.

Care and Maintenance: Keeping Them Looking New

One of the most appreciated benefits of PVC panels is their minimal maintenance requirements. Unlike porous materials that harbor mildew or require harsh cleaners, PVC is non-absorbent and chemical-resistant.

  • Routine Cleaning: A simple solution of warm water and mild dish soap applied with a soft cloth or sponge is all that's needed for everyday dust and grime. Rinse with a clean, damp cloth.
  • Tough Stains: For soap scum or hard water deposits, a vinegar-water solution or a commercial cleaner labeled safe for PVC/vinyl is effective. Always test any cleaner on an inconspicuous area first.
  • What to Avoid: Abrasive scrubbers (steel wool, scouring pads), harsh solvents (acetone, paint thinner), and ammonia-based cleaners can dull the finish or cause discoloration. Never use a pressure washer on interior panels.
  • Long-Term Care: Periodically check the sealant at the top, bottom, and corners of the installation, especially in wet areas. Reapply 100% silicone caulk if you notice any gaps to maintain the waterproof integrity.

Frequently Asked Questions (FAQs)

Q: Can PVC wall panels 4x8 be painted?
A: It's generally not recommended and often voids warranties. The surface is designed to be a finished product. Painting can lead to poor adhesion and peeling. If you must change the color, look for panels specifically manufactured as "paintable" PVC.

Q: Are they fire-rated?
A: Many PVC panels have a Class A fire rating (the highest for building materials) or a Class B rating. You must check the specific product's technical data sheet (TDS) for its exact fire classification (ASTM E84) to ensure it meets your local building code requirements, especially for commercial projects.

Q: How do I handle outlets and switches?
A: You will need electrical box extenders (also called "box risers" or "old-work extenders"). Once the panel is installed over the existing box, the outlet will be recessed. The extender screws onto the existing box, bringing the outlet forward to the new wall surface.

Q: What about insulation?
A: PVC panels themselves provide minimal insulation (R-0.5 to R-1 typically). They are a finish material. For insulation, you must install rigid foam board or batts between the studs before applying the PVC panels. Some products come with an integrated foam backing, which offers a slight boost.

Q: Can I install them over tile?
A: Yes, in many cases. As long as the existing tile is well-adhered, flat, and clean, you can install PVC panels directly over it using a high-quality construction adhesive and mechanical fasteners. This is a popular way to update an old tile shower without a full demolition.
